Ukraine launches over 600 drones in massive overnight assault on Russian regions

Summary

Ukraine launched a massive drone assault on Russian regions overnight on June 26, deploying over 600 drones. Primary targets included the Tula region, where the Azot chemical plant in Novomoskovsk and the city's power station were struck and set ablaze. Tula Governor Dmitry Milyayev reported 157 drones shot down and damage to an industrial facility and a private home, with one woman injured. Moscow was also targeted, with Mayor Sergei Sobyanin reporting at least 47 drones intercepted.
